]>
Commit | Line | Data |
---|---|---|
1 | #ifndef ALIEMCALPID_H | |
2 | #define ALIEMCALPID_H | |
3 | ||
4 | /* $Id$ */ | |
5 | ||
6 | /////////////////////////////////////////////////////////////////////////////// | |
7 | // Class AliEMCALPID | |
8 | // Compute PID weights for all the clusters | |
9 | /////////////////////////////////////////////////////////////////////////////// | |
10 | ||
11 | //Root includes | |
12 | #include "TTask.h" | |
13 | class TArrayD ; | |
14 | ||
15 | //AliRoot includes | |
16 | class AliESDEvent ; | |
17 | #include "AliEMCALPIDUtils.h" | |
18 | ||
19 | class AliEMCALPID : public AliEMCALPIDUtils { | |
20 | ||
21 | public: | |
22 | ||
23 | AliEMCALPID(); | |
24 | AliEMCALPID(Bool_t reconstructor); | |
25 | //virtual ~AliEMCALPID() { } | |
26 | ||
27 | void RunPID(AliESDEvent *esd); | |
28 | void InitParameters(); | |
29 | void SetReconstructor(Bool_t yesno) {fReconstructor = yesno;} | |
30 | ||
31 | private: | |
32 | ||
33 | Bool_t fReconstructor; // Fill esdcalocluster when called from EMCALReconstructor | |
34 | ||
35 | ClassDef(AliEMCALPID, 5) | |
36 | ||
37 | }; | |
38 | ||
39 | ||
40 | #endif // ALIEMCALPID_H | |
41 | ||
42 |